James smith dashner born november 26, 1972 is an american writer of speculative fiction, primarily series for children or young adults, such as the maze runner series and the young adult fantasy series the th reality. The maze runner is a 2009 young adult dystopian science fiction novel written by american author james dashner and the first book released in the maze runner series. The death cure is a 2011 young adult dystopian science fiction novel written by american writer james dashner and the third book published in the maze runner series the fifth and last in narrative order. The novel was published on october 7, 2009 by delacorte press, an imprint of random house, and was made into a 2014 major motion picture by 20th century fox.
